Symptoms

  • •Engine temperature gauge reading higher than normal
  • •Steam or smoke coming from under the hood
  • •Warning lights illuminated on the dashboard
  • •Low coolant level in the reservoir
  • •Unusual noises from the engine area
  • •Sweet smell of coolant (indicating a leak)

Solution
1. Preparation
  • Gather necessary tools and parts.
  • Park the vehicle on a level surface and allow the engine to cool completely.
  • Disconnect the negative battery terminal to ensure safety.
2. Inspect and Replace Coolant
  • Tools Required: Radiator funnel, coolant, drain pan
  • Open the radiator cap and inspect for coolant levels.
  • If low, drain the old coolant from the radiator into a drain pan.
  • Refill with the appropriate type and mixture of coolant as per manufacturer specifications.
3. Check and Replace Thermostat
  • Tools Required: Socket set, new thermostat
  • Locate the thermostat housing and remove the bolts using a socket set.
  • Remove the thermostat and inspect for proper opening and closing.
  • Replace with a new thermostat if faulty, ensuring proper alignment and sealing.
4. Inspect and Repair or Replace Hoses
  • Tools Required: Pliers, hose clamps
  • Visually inspect all hoses for cracks, leaks, or wear.
  • If damaged, remove the hose clamps and replace with new hoses.
  • Ensure all connections are tight and secure.
5. Test and Repair Radiator Fan
  • Tools Required: Multimeter
  • Turn on the vehicle and allow it to reach operating temperature.
  • Check if the radiator fan activates when the engine reaches a certain temperature using a multimeter.
  • If the fan does not work, replace the fan motor or associated relay.
